Rain gutter repair services involve inspecting and fixing issues with the existing gutter system on a property. This work typically includes resealing leaks, realigning misaligned gutters, replacing damaged sections, and ensuring that the entire system functions properly. Proper gutter repair helps prevent water from spilling over the sides or pooling around the foundation, which can cause significant damage over time. When gutters become cracked, sagging, or clogged, professional repair can restore their effectiveness and protect the home’s structure.

Many common problems lead homeowners to seek gutter repair services. These include overflowing gutters during heavy rain, which often indicates blockages or broken sections; sagging or detached gutters caused by rust, corrosion, or loose brackets; and leaks that develop at seams or joints. Over time, gutters can also develop cracks or holes from weather exposure, leading to water damage inside the home or on the exterior walls. Addressing these issues promptly with professional repair helps avoid costly repairs to the roof, siding, or foundation caused by improper drainage.

Gutter repair services are often needed for residential properties, especially those with older or custom-designed gutter systems. Single-family homes, townhouses, and multi-unit complexes all benefit from regular inspections and repairs to maintain proper water flow. Properties with complex rooflines or multiple levels may require more frequent attention to ensure that water is directed away from the structure effectively. Whether a home is new or decades old, professional gutter repair can help maintain its exterior integrity and prevent water-related issues.

Homeowners should consider gutter repair services when noticing signs of water damage, such as staining on walls or ceilings, or if gutters are visibly sagging or pulling away from the house. Other indicators include excessive debris buildup, overflowing during rainstorms, or rust and corrosion on metal gutters. Regular inspections and timely repairs can extend the lifespan of the gutter system and protect the property from water damage. The overview below groups typical Rain Gutter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Kingwood, TX.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typically, minor gutter repairs such as fixing leaks or replacing sections cost between $150 and $500. Many routine jobs fall within this range, especially for straightforward issues on single-story homes. Larger or more complex repairs may reach higher amounts but are less common.

Gutter Cleaning - Gutter cleaning services generally range from $100 to $300 depending on the size of the property and level of debris. Most residential projects land in this middle range, with fewer jobs requiring extensive cleaning or additional repairs.

Full Gutter System Replacement - Replacing an entire gutter system often costs between $1,500 and $4,000 for typical homes. Larger or multi-story properties can see costs exceeding $5,000, but these are less frequent than standard replacements.

Complex or Custom Projects - Larger, more intricate gutter projects, such as custom designs or extensive upgrades, can reach $5,000 or more. These jobs are less common and usually involve specialized materials or unusual property features.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s that rain gutters need repair? Visible leaks, sagging gutters, overflowing during rain, and rust or corrosion are typical indicators that gutter repairs may be necessary.

Can damaged gutters cause other issues around my home? Yes, damaged gutters can lead to water damage, foundation problems, and mold growth if not properly repaired or maintained.

What types of gutter repairs do local contractors typically handle? They often address leaks, loose or broken brackets, sagging sections, and damaged downspouts to restore proper function.

How can I prevent future gutter problems? Regular inspections, cleaning debris, and timely repairs can help prevent clogs, rust, and structural issues with gutters.

Why should I hire a professional for gutter repair instead of DIY? Professionals have the experience and tools to ensure repairs are done correctly, reducing the risk of further damage or improper fixes.
